In 1960, three Mirabal sisters in the Dominican Republic were assassinated after visiting their jailed husbands who were suspected rebel leaders. The sisters became mythical figures in their country, where they are known as Las Mariposas (the butterflies). In this novel, the author, Julia Alvarez frames the story of the three sisters within the life of a fourth sister from 1940s, who dedicated her life to the memory of her sisters. The inspired portrait of the four women is a disturbing statement about the cost of political oppression.
